Subject: [Qemu-devel] [RFC 1/8] pc: disable bochs bios debug ports (do not apply!)
Date: Sun, 23 Dec 2012 16:32:41 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1356276769-7357-2-git-send-email-hpoussin@reactos.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1356276769-7357-1-git-send-email-hpoussin@reactos.org>
This patch must not be applied as-is.
Some patches to use MemoryRegion have already been sent to
mailing list, but none has been applied yet.
---
hw/pc.c | 6 ++++++
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)
diff --git a/hw/pc.c b/hw/pc.c
index b11e7c4..7f98955 100644
--- a/hw/pc.c
+++ b/hw/pc.c
@@ -524,6 +524,7 @@ static void handle_a20_line_change(void *opaque, int irq, int level)
cpu_x86_set_a20(cpu, level);
}
+#if 0
/***********************************************************/
/* Bochs BIOS debug ports */
@@ -551,6 +552,7 @@ static void bochs_bios_write(void *opaque, uint32_t addr, uint32_t val)
exit((val << 1) | 1);
}
}
+#endif
int e820_add_entry(uint64_t address, uint64_t length, uint32_t type)
{
@@ -569,6 +571,7 @@ int e820_add_entry(uint64_t address, uint64_t length, uint32_t type)
return index;
}
+#if 0
static const MemoryRegionPortio bochs_bios_portio_list[] = {
{ 0x500, 1, 1, .write = bochs_bios_write, }, /* 0x500 */
{ 0x501, 1, 1, .write = bochs_bios_write, }, /* 0x501 */
@@ -576,6 +579,7 @@ static const MemoryRegionPortio bochs_bios_portio_list[] = {
{ 0x8900, 1, 1, .write = bochs_bios_write, }, /* 0x8900 */
PORTIO_END_OF_LIST(),
};
+#endif
static void *bochs_bios_init(void)
{
@@ -584,11 +588,13 @@ static void *bochs_bios_init(void)
size_t smbios_len;
uint64_t *numa_fw_cfg;
int i, j;
+#if 0
PortioList *bochs_bios_port_list = g_new(PortioList, 1);
portio_list_init(bochs_bios_port_list, bochs_bios_portio_list,
NULL, "bochs-bios");
portio_list_add(bochs_bios_port_list, get_system_io(), 0x0);
+#endif
fw_cfg = fw_cfg_init(BIOS_CFG_IOPORT, BIOS_CFG_IOPORT + 1, 0, 0);
